What affects the price

When you start pricing out an electric fireplace, a few main things change the bottom line. First, size matters—a massive wall-mounted unit or a custom built-in insert will cost more than a standard portable heater. If you want high-end features like realistic 3D flame effects, smart home integration, or crackling sound components, expect to pay more for the technology. Installation also shifts the cost; simple plug-and-play models are cheaper than those requiring hardwiring or carpentry work. How much electricity do electric fireplaces with heaters use in San Diego?

Electric fireplaces with heaters in San Diego generally consume between 1,000 to 1,500 watts when the heating element is active, comparable to a standard space heater. The flame-only effect uses significantly less power, often under 20 watts. What is the difference between an electric fire and an electric fireplace?

The terms 'electric fire' and 'electric fireplace' are often used interchangeably, referring to the same type of appliance that simulates a real fire using electricity. In San Diego, these units provide visual ambiance and often supplemental heat. The key components are the flame effect, which can be LED or other technologies, and sometimes a heating element.
